The central bank mandates that, from January 1, 2026, Authorised Dealer Category-II banks, entities, and full-fledged money changers must directly submit a "LRS daily return" (including nil returns) on the Centralised Information Management System. They will gain CIMS access to verify cumulative PAN-wise remittances under the Liberalised Remittance Scheme in the current financial year before processing further transactions. Consequently, these entities may stop routing LRS transaction reporting through Authorised Dealer Category-I banks. All authorised persons must follow the CIMS user manual and may approach the relevant regional foreign exchange department for operational issues. The Master Direction on FEMA reporting will be updated accordingly.
